UBC 1153 is a poorly populated, very loose object of intermediate C3 quality. Its parallax locates it at a moderate distance, below the mid-plane, affected by moderate extinction. It is catalogued as a near-solar metallicity, young cluster (see Parameters). It is poorly studied in the literature.
